Sheinbaum's Diplomatic Success Boosts Approval Ratings Amidst US Trade Tensions
Mexican President Claudia Sheinbaum's approval ratings have soared after successfully averting US tariffs through diplomatic talks with President Trump, strengthening her image and unifying the nation behind her, while also prompting domestic policy reforms.
- What is the primary reason for the significant increase in President Sheinbaum's approval ratings?
- Mexican President Claudia Sheinbaum's approval ratings have surged due to her handling of US-Mexico trade relations. Her diplomatic approach, including direct talks with President Trump, has so far averted threatened tariffs, boosting her image as a strong and capable leader. This success has unified the nation behind her, with even the opposition offering support.
- What are the potential long-term implications of President Sheinbaum's actions, both domestically and internationally?
- Sheinbaum's success in navigating the US trade threat provides a platform for domestic policy reforms. While facing challenges from within her own party, she has used the international pressure to strengthen border security, combat drug trafficking, and extradite high-profile criminals to the US. These actions, while controversial, demonstrate a departure from her predecessor's policies and aim to address long-standing issues.
- How does President Sheinbaum's approach to the US trade dispute compare to that of other world leaders, and what accounts for her success?
- Sheinbaum's strategy contrasts sharply with other world leaders' responses to Trump's pressures. Unlike more confrontational approaches, her measured diplomacy has yielded tangible results, avoiding the imposition of 25% tariffs on Mexican exports to the US. This success is attributed to her calm demeanor and willingness to engage Trump directly, earning her international praise.
Cognitive Concepts
Framing Bias
The narrative strongly frames Sheinbaum in a positive light, emphasizing her successes in managing the Trump threat and portraying her as a strong, capable leader. The headline (if one were to be created based on this article) would likely focus on her triumphs. The introductory paragraphs highlight her international acclaim and the support she enjoys, reinforcing a positive image. The sequencing of information, starting with her successes and only later mentioning domestic challenges, impacts the reader's perception.
Language Bias
The article uses language that paints Sheinbaum in a favorable light. Words and phrases like "nervio templado" (strong nerves), "mujer de palabra" (woman of her word), and "ha encontrado el tono" (has found the right tone) carry positive connotations. While not inherently biased, the cumulative effect of such positive descriptions creates a favorable image. More neutral alternatives might include phrases like "Sheinbaum has demonstrated resilience" or "Sheinbaum's approach has proven successful in recent negotiations.
Bias by Omission
The article focuses heavily on Sheinbaum's relationship with Trump and her successes in foreign policy, potentially omitting or downplaying significant issues in domestic policy. While the article mentions the flawed judicial election and delayed anti-nepotism legislation, these issues receive far less attention than the international relations aspect. The article also omits discussion of potential negative consequences of extraditing drug cartel leaders to the US, such as potential human rights abuses within the US justice system. The extent to which these omissions are intentional or due to space constraints is unclear, however they limit a comprehensive understanding of Sheinbaum's presidency.
False Dichotomy
The article presents a somewhat simplistic dichotomy between Sheinbaum's successful handling of Trump and the perceived failures of other world leaders. This framing overlooks the complexities of international relations and the various factors influencing each leader's situation. While Sheinbaum's approach might be effective in this specific context, it doesn't necessarily translate to a universally superior strategy.
